• Jetzt anmelden. Es dauert nur 2 Minuten und ist kostenlos!

Transparente PNG-Grafiken im IE6

Status
Für weitere Antworten geschlossen.

cyberkuh

Neues Mitglied
Das Problem ist ja allgemein bekannt und durch das eine oder andere Fix leicht zu beheben.

Leider greifen dieses Fixes nur bei Grafiken, die direkt durch einen IMG Tag eingebunden werden.

Wenn man in CSS Dateien über background-image ein Bild einbindet, funktionieren diese Fixes somit leider nicht.

Gibt es ein Fix, was es auch erlaubt transparente PNG-Grafiken per CSS einzubinden.

Vielen Dank
 
wenn die PNG Grafik wirklich transparent ist, kannst du sie einfach einbinden, wo ist das problem?
Ansonsten nutz doch einfach CSS um es transparent zu bekommen

Code:
	-moz-opacity : 0.40;
	-khtml-opacity : 0.40;
	opacity : 0.40;
	filter : alpha(opacity=40);
 
jop sag ich doch ;)

Habe das gerade mal ausprobiert, schwarzer Hintergrund mit einer PNG Grafik die praktisch ein weißen kreis darstellt und in der mitte transparent ist.

Funktioniert in IE 6, 7 und in Firefox - mit anderen Browsern hab ich es nicht getestet.
 
vl meint er das: mach eine grafik als bg-image und dann machst du folgendes mit der angehängten datei:

speichere sie in den ordner wo deine html-daten sind und im style sagst du (dort wo dein bg-image ist):

PHP:
#div{
    behavior: url(deinhtmlordner/iepngfix.htc);
}
 
Status
Für weitere Antworten geschlossen.
Zurück
Oben